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Amazonian Marsh Rat | Broad skate |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Elasmobranchii |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Rajiformes (Rajiformes)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Rajidae |
| Genus | Holochilus | Amblyraja |
| Species | Holochilus sciureus | Amblyraja badia |
Evolutionary Relationship
Amazonian Marsh Rat and Broad skate share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
